Building on the ongoing collaboration in digital denture manufacturing, Dentsply Sirona and HeyGears announced the successful validation of Lucitone Digital Print Denture resins for one-piece denture production on the new HeyGears UltraCraft Multi-Material Fusion (MMF) DLP 3D printer. This validation provides an efficient production pathway that eliminates the need to bond Lucitone Digital IPN® 3D premium denture teeth to the denture base while still delivering the durability, esthetics, and performance clinicians expect from Lucitone materials.¹

The Lucitone Digital Print Denture System is recognized for its leading mechanical strength, esthetics, longevity, and streamlined digital workflow for full-arch and partial dentures. It is available in 16 A-D* plus 2 bleach tooth shades and five gingiva shades.
HeyGears’ comprehensive dental 3D printing portfolio is designed to deliver efficient, automated, and highly accurate workflows through advanced pre-processing software, print management solutions, and reliable hardware. The arrival of HeyGears’ new UltraCraft MMF 3D printer enables the seamless production of one-piece dentures via a full-chain solution covering all key steps, from design to pre-processing to the final product. According to HeyGears, the no-bonding-required monolithic dentures fully preserve tooth anatomy for natural, balanced occlusion. Meanwhile, the seamless surface inhibits bacterial growth for a cleaner, healthier oral environment.
